Summary
Dignity for our Nation's Heroes Act - Authorizes the Secretary of Veterans Affairs (VA) to cover the burial and funeral expenses of a deceased veteran: (1) who is homeless, has no next of kin or other person claiming the body, and does not have sufficient resources to cover such expenses; (2) whose service in the Armed Forces was not during wartime; and (3) who was either discharged under honorable conditions or died during a period deemed to be active service. Prohibits any deduction from the burial allowance because of a veteran's assets or because of any contribution toward the burial and funeral expenses, unless the expenses incurred are covered by the United States, a state, an agency or political subdivision of the United States or a state, or the veteran's employer.
